They like me so much they are pretending not to like me.” Nica Cheryl Lee Scott is a comedian, artist, writer and designer based in Los Angeles. A second generation Angelino, born and raised in the San Fernando Valley, she graduated from UCLA in 1999. In 2015 Cheryl opened a contemporary art space in the heart of L.A., Chainlink Gallery. This passion project was the result of her strong desire to connect people together in real life. After two years and ten exhibitions, Cheryl took the business online. Her first comedy showcase was at the Hollywood Improv in February 2018, under the tutelage of comic and voice over actor Lesley Wolff. That performance got her booked into a show at The Comedy Store where you can see her perform once a month. In November 2018 she was accepted into the Palm Springs International Comedy Festival. Cheryl lives in West Los Angeles and has two children with her ex-husband. She is currently taking a screenwriting class at her alma mater, UCLA, and preparing herself for coming back in her next life as a man. You’ll have to see her do stand up to understand that one!
